Grant CommentsOutput Power is EIRP and ERP for above and below 1 GHz, respectively, except for Part 90 LTE Band 26 emissions, which are conducted. SAR compliance for body-worn operating configurations is limited to belt-clips and holsters that have no metallic components in the assembly and cause the device to operate with the minimum separation distance of 15 mm, as described in this filing. End-users must be informed of the body-worn operating requirements for satisfying RF exposure compliance. The highest reported SAR for head, body-worn accessory, product specific (wireless router), and simultaneous transmission and product specific (10g SAR) exposure conditions are 1.18 W/kg, 0.50 W/kg, 1.16 W/kg, 1.52 W/kg and 3.56 W/kg, respectively. This device supports LTE of 1.4, 3, 5, 10, 15 and 20 MHz bandwidth modes for FDD LTE Bands 2, 4 and 66; LTE of 5, 10, 15, 20, 30, 35 and 40 MHz bandwidth modes for FDD LTE Band 7; LTE of 1.4, 3, 5 and 10 MHz bandwidth modes for FDD LTE Bands 5 and 12; LTE of 5 and 10 MHz bandwidth modes for FDD LTE Band 17; LTE of 1.4, 3, 5, 10 and 15 MHz bandwidth modes for FDD LTE Band 26; LTE of 5 and 10 MHz bandwidth modes for FDD LTE Band 17; LTE of 1.4, 3, 5, 10 and 15 MHz bandwidth modes for FDD LTE Band 26; LTE of 5, 10, 15, 20, 30 and 40 MHz bandwidth modes for TDD LTE Band 38; LTE of 5, 10, 15, 20, 25, 30, 35 and 40 MHz bandwidth modes for TDD LTE Band 41. This device also supports Frequency Range 1 5G NR modes of 5, 15 and 20 MHz bandwidth modes for FDD Band 7; Frequency Range 1 5G NR modes of 20, 60 and 100 MHz bandwidth modes for TDD Band 41. This device supports intra-band carrier aggregation techniques for FDD LTE Band 7, TDD LTE Band 38 and band 41. This device contains functions that are not operational in U.S. Territories; this filing is applicable only for U.S. operations.
